Triswim Lotion zen grapefruit
Yes. Yes, Triswim Lotion zen grapefruit is alcohol-free.
No drying alcohol (Alcohol Denat, Ethanol, SD Alcohol, Isopropyl Alcohol) in the list.
Why
Alcohol-free means no drying alcohol: Alcohol Denat, Ethanol, SD Alcohol, Isopropyl Alcohol. Fatty alcohols like Cetearyl Alcohol are waxes and never count, and Benzyl Alcohol is a preservative.
Yes, Triswim Lotion zen grapefruit is alcohol-free. No drying alcohol (Alcohol Denat, Ethanol, SD Alcohol, Isopropyl Alcohol) in the list.
Cetearyl Alcohol is a fatty alcohol: waxy, softening, and never counted as alcohol.
